The Role
Ventia are seeking to engage a qualified and experienced
Plumbing, Fire & Reticulation Supervisor to join our Defence Base Services contact. This position is based at RAAF Base Pearce in Bullsbrook and will see you working within the Estate upkeep team as part of our national Defence contract.
The successful applicant will be responsible for maintaining all fire hydraulic suppression systems with broad knowledge of both wet and dry systems.
In addition, this role will provide supervision and co-ordination of all trades to effectively maintain, repair, replace and ensure the integrity and performance of facilities and equipment.
This is a full-time permanent role, working Monday-Friday from 07:00am to 03:30pm (with some flexibility).
- To be considered for this position, you must be an Australian Citizen and willing to undergo a police check._
Key duties, but not limited to:
- Supervision of in-house trade's staff and subcontractors for all General Estate Works (GEW) under the Defence Contract
- Inspection/validation of the physical work to ensure compliance with set quality and technical standards
- Ensure reporting and compliance of activities is completed and maintained
- Assist with Planning, Scheduling and allocation of activities to be completed within allocated budgets and timeframes
- Ensure accounts are maintained with appropriate suppliers to ensure equipment and services are available to tradespersons
- Demonstrated knowledge of relevant industry WHS and promote a safe working environment for all staff and subcontractors
- Attend scheduled meetings with Trades, Sub-Contractors and Customer Representatives, to monitor progress and address issues that could affect Safety, quality, schedule and cost etc
Skills and Experience:
- Experience and understanding of a variety of Fire Suppression Systems
- Formal trade background with experience in facilities maintenance on a range of building related works and repairs
- Ability to consistently deliver when under pressure and dealing with integrated systems and potential hazards
- Demonstrated experience in leading and motivating in house trades, including contractors and subcontractors
- Flexible to meet the demands of afterhours work and the ability to participate in an oncall roster
- Strong oral and written communication skills
- Competent in the use of the MS Office suite, SAP and Power BI is highly regarded
